This is my colleague, Marcia Grant, who oversees health promotion in the camp. She says many people are shocked when they realise flies sit on food and vomit into it. Lots of children in the camp have scabies.

In 1990 I was a nurse at a Monrovia hospital. When the war began rebels took over the hospital, forcing us to care for them. I couldn't leave for five months because of all the killings.

When peacekeepers arrived I fled to Ghana. After two years the Red Cross found my family in Sierra Leone. We all met up again in Liberia.
